Local denial of service via unsafe UCSI teardown
Published Sep 13, 2024 · Updated May 23, 2026
A denial-of-service flaw in Linux kernel UCSI GLINK code allows local users to crash affected systems through device teardown. The pmic_glink callback invokes sleepable ucsi_unregister() while holding a spinlock in IRQ context; deferred teardown can then call pmic_glink_send() after its link is gone and dereference NULL. Exploitation requires local low-privileged access and affected Qualcomm PMIC GLINK UCSI hardware, and the bounded impact is a kernel crash rather than data access or modification.
